I've had thoughts about actually penalizing sites that list such vast
amounts of IP space in their SPF records or perhaps just ignoring those
large ranges in the SPF validation. I suppose it would be plagued with
false positives, but if enough people did it, it would give some
priority to actually think about your SMTP flows when setting up your
SPF records.
